Our lab develops and uses approaches to analyze genomes, other omes, and regulatory networks. We apply these approaches to understand human variation and health

Our PRS-Net is out Genome Research. PRS-Net is a biologically-informed GNN-based PRS model for improving disease/trait prediction. genome.cshlp.org/cgi/content/lo…

I learned in our aging class that the lung has 30X the surface area of the skin. The lung surface area is the size of a racquet ball court! Found a relevant article: pmc.ncbi.nlm.nih.gov/articles/PMC88…
